博客 数据中台英文版:架构设计与技术实现

数据中台英文版:架构设计与技术实现

   数栈君   发表于 2026-01-23 14:54  108  0

Data Middle Platform: Architecture Design and Technical Implementation

In the digital age, businesses are increasingly relying on data-driven decision-making to gain a competitive edge. The concept of a data middle platform (DMP) has emerged as a pivotal solution to streamline data management, integration, and analysis. This article delves into the architecture design and technical implementation of a data middle platform, providing actionable insights for businesses and individuals interested in data-centric solutions.


What is a Data Middle Platform?

A data middle platform is a centralized system designed to aggregate, process, and analyze data from diverse sources. It serves as an intermediary layer between raw data and end-users, enabling organizations to extract actionable insights efficiently. The primary objectives of a DMP include:

  • Data Integration: Combining data from multiple sources (e.g., databases, APIs, IoT devices) into a unified format.
  • Data Processing: Cleansing, transforming, and enriching raw data to ensure accuracy and relevance.
  • Data Analysis: Leveraging advanced analytics techniques (e.g., machine learning, AI) to derive meaningful insights.
  • Data Visualization: Presenting data in an intuitive format (e.g., dashboards, reports) for decision-making.

Architecture Design Principles

The architecture of a data middle platform is critical to its performance, scalability, and reliability. Below are key principles that guide its design:

1. Modular Design

A modular architecture allows for flexibility and scalability. Each component of the DMP (e.g., data ingestion, processing, storage) operates independently, making it easier to update or replace individual modules without disrupting the entire system.

2. Scalability

To handle large volumes of data, the platform must be scalable. This can be achieved through distributed computing frameworks (e.g., Apache Hadoop, Apache Spark) and cloud-based infrastructure.

3. Real-Time Processing

Many businesses require real-time data processing to respond to dynamic conditions. Technologies like Apache Kafka (for event streaming) and Apache Flink (for real-time analytics) are essential for achieving low-latency processing.

4. Security and Compliance

Data security is a top priority. The DMP must incorporate robust security measures, such as encryption, role-based access control, and compliance with regulations like GDPR and CCPA.

5. Integration with Existing Systems

The platform should seamlessly integrate with existing enterprise systems (e.g., CRM, ERP) to ensure data consistency and avoid silos.


Technical Implementation

The technical implementation of a data middle platform involves several stages, from data ingestion to visualization. Below is a detailed breakdown:

1. Data Ingestion

Data is collected from various sources, including databases, APIs, IoT devices, and flat files. Tools like Apache Kafka, Apache Flume, and AWS Kinesis are commonly used for efficient data ingestion.

2. Data Storage

Data is stored in a centralized repository, which can be a relational database, NoSQL database, or a data lake. For large-scale data storage, distributed file systems like Hadoop HDFS or cloud storage solutions (e.g., AWS S3, Google Cloud Storage) are preferred.

3. Data Processing

Raw data is processed to clean, transform, and enrich it. This stage may involve ETL (Extract, Transform, Load) pipelines, machine learning models, or rule-based systems. Frameworks like Apache Spark, Apache Flink, and Apache Airflow are widely used for orchestration.

4. Data Analysis

Advanced analytics are performed to derive insights. This includes descriptive analytics (e.g., summarizing data), predictive analytics (e.g., forecasting trends), and prescriptive analytics (e.g., recommending actions). Tools like Apache Hadoop, Apache TensorFlow, and Tableau are often employed.

5. Data Visualization

The final stage involves presenting data in a user-friendly format. Dashboards, reports, and interactive visualizations are created using tools like Tableau, Power BI, or Looker. These platforms enable users to explore data dynamically and make informed decisions.


Digital Twin and Digital Visualization

1. Digital Twin

A digital twin is a virtual representation of a physical entity, such as a product, process, or system. It leverages real-time data to simulate and predict the behavior of its counterpart. Digital twins are widely used in industries like manufacturing, healthcare, and urban planning.

  • Architecture: A digital twin typically consists of three components:

    • Physical Entity: The real-world object being modeled.
    • Digital Model: A virtual representation of the entity, often built using CAD software or simulation tools.
    • Data Integration: Real-time data from sensors and other sources is fed into the digital model to update its state.
  • Use Cases:

    • Predictive maintenance in manufacturing.
    • Simulating patient outcomes in healthcare.
    • Optimizing urban infrastructure planning.

2. Digital Visualization

Digital visualization refers to the process of representing data in a digital format, often using advanced tools and techniques. It is closely related to data visualization but focuses on creating immersive and interactive experiences.

  • Techniques:

    • 3D Visualization: Creating 3D models and simulations.
    • Augmented Reality (AR): Overlaying digital information onto the physical world.
    • Virtual Reality (VR): Immersive experiences that simulate a virtual environment.
  • Tools:

    • Unity and Unreal Engine for 3D rendering.
    • Tableau and Power BI for data visualization.
    • AR/VR platforms like Microsoft HoloLens and Oculus.

Challenges and Future Trends

1. Challenges

  • Data Silos: Ensuring seamless integration of disparate data sources remains a significant challenge.
  • Data Quality: Maintaining data accuracy and consistency across the platform.
  • Scalability: Handling exponential growth in data volumes and user demands.
  • Security: Protecting sensitive data from cyber threats and ensuring compliance with regulations.

2. Future Trends

  • AI-Driven Automation: Leveraging AI to automate data processing, analysis, and visualization.
  • Edge Computing: Processing data closer to the source to reduce latency and improve efficiency.
  • 5G Technology: Enabling real-time data transmission and faster communication between devices.
  • Blockchain: Enhancing data security and transparency through decentralized ledgers.

Conclusion

A data middle platform is a powerful tool for organizations looking to harness the full potential of their data. By adopting a well-designed architecture and leveraging cutting-edge technologies, businesses can achieve seamless data integration, real-time processing, and actionable insights. As digital transformation continues to accelerate, the role of data middle platforms in driving innovation and efficiency will only grow.

If you're interested in exploring the capabilities of a data middle platform, consider 申请试用 to experience firsthand how it can transform your data management and analytics processes.


This article provides a comprehensive overview of the architecture design and technical implementation of a data middle platform, along with insights into digital twin and digital visualization. By following these principles, businesses can unlock the full value of their data and stay ahead in the competitive digital landscape.

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料